Aims, contents and method of the course
Nine research units are prepared to lead small groups of students (max. 12) through the theory and praxis of techniques used in neuroscience research. The topics covered are i) neuroanatomy/histology; ii) biochemistry and pharmacology of nerve conduction; iii) electrophysiology; iv) the sensory system; v) cellular neurobiology; vi) disorders of the nervous system; vii) neuroimmunology; viii) cognitive neuroscience; ix) molecular biology of the nervous system. This course is held in English language. There are small written tests at the end of each laboratory course the final grade is the average of the nine evaluations during the laboratory tutorials.
